What Makes Tung Oil Different
Tung oil derives from the seeds of the tung tree and hardens through oxidation rather than evaporation. This process creates a flexible, waterproof surface that resists cracking over time. Unlike synthetic finishes that form a surface film, tung oil soaks into the wood fibers and bonds internally. The outcome yields a subtle sheen that accentuates grain patterns without obscuring them.
Beyond aesthetics, pure tung oil includes no petroleum solvents or metallic dryers, rendering it non-toxic after curing. This quality proves essential in households with children, pets, or individuals sensitive to fumes. Products labeled food-safe allow application on cutting boards and salad bowls.
The curing mechanism produces a polymerized layer within the wood that repels water yet permits breathability. This adaptability handles seasonal expansion and contraction without peeling or blistering. Such properties suit solid wood countertops and furniture exposed to temperature variations.
When selecting products, seek labels specifying 100 percent pure tung oil. Steer clear of blends with mineral spirits or varnish additives to maximize environmental benefits.
Application and Performance in Real Use
Applying tung oil demands patience yet yields superior results. Thin coats penetrate deeply, so multiple layers build the optimal finish. Light sanding between applications ensures even absorption.
Typical process:
- Sand the surface to 220 grit and remove all dust.
- Apply a thin coat using a lint-free cloth.
- Allow 24 hours for absorption.
- Repeat for three to five coats until the surface no longer accepts additional oil.
- Permit the final coat to cure for one week before subjecting it to heavy use.
One quart covers approximately 125 to 150 square feet across three coats. The result offers a satin glow rather than a high-gloss shell. For increased sheen, buff with a soft cloth or apply a beeswax topcoat.
In performance tests, tung oil withstands alcohol, mild acids, and short-term water exposure more effectively than linseed oil or shellac. It also resists the yellowing common in polyurethane finishes over time.
Schedule finishing tasks in warm, dry environments. High humidity delays polymerization and may produce a tacky residue lasting several days.
Costs and Budget Considerations
Pure tung oil carries a higher initial cost compared to blended alternatives. Prices range from $18 to $35 per quart or $70 to $120 per gallon. However, its efficient coverage offsets this, with one gallon treating 400 to 500 square feet.
Price factors:
- Purity level: Blended products cost less but often include petroleum solvents.
- Wood type: Dense species like maple require less oil than open-grained oak.
- Desired finish: Additional coats enhance color and protection but increase usage.
Money-saving strategies:
- Purchase in bulk for extensive projects.
- Use lint-free rags for application to minimize waste.
- Apply a single refresher coat annually instead of complete refinishing.
Resist the temptation of products labeled tung oil finish, which frequently conceal synthetic varnish blends. These options dry quickly but release strong odors and forfeit eco-friendly attributes.
Before buying, review the Material Safety Data Sheet. Authentic tung oil lists only tung oil as the ingredient.
DIY or Professional Use
Tung oil accommodates beginners while meeting the demands of professional workshops. Patience remains the primary requirement. Its extended curing time favors controlled indoor settings over rapid production schedules.
DIY skill check:
- Tools needed: Lint-free cloths, 220-grit sandpaper, gloves, and clean rags.
- Time commitment: Approximately 15 minutes per coat for application, plus curing periods.
- Skill level: Moderate. The method proves straightforward but demands consistency.
Opt for DIY on small furniture, cutting boards, or trim. Delegate large flooring installations or premium cabinetry to professionals, where uniform absorption and dust management prove crucial.
When engaging a professional, verify their use of pure tung oil rather than polymerized variants, unless faster drying suits your needs. Request sample boards to assess color and sheen in advance.
Store excess oil in a sealed metal container with limited air exposure. Oxygen contact thickens the oil during storage and diminishes its efficacy.
Common Mistakes to Avoid
Even seasoned woodworkers encounter pitfalls with natural finishes. Frequent errors encompass:
- Over-application: Thick layers trap uncured oil within the wood. Wipe away excess after 15 minutes.
- Inadequate preparation: Neglecting sanding or dust removal leads to uneven spots.
- Incompatible layering: Applying polyurethane over uncured tung oil results in clouding.
- Improper rag disposal: Oily cloths pose a spontaneous combustion risk. Submerge used rags in water and seal them in a container before discarding.
To remedy a sticky surface post-curing, buff gently with 0000 steel wool and add a thin fresh coat. This action stimulates oxidation.
Maintaining and Enjoying the Finish
After full curing, tung oil establishes a resilient, renewable barrier. Water forms beads on the surface, and minor scratches repair easily without full resurfacing. A simple application of fresh oil revives the shine. Gradually, the wood acquires a patina unique to natural finishes, unmatched by synthetics.
